However today I was reading a post and a statement from the University of Bath study caught my eye
It said “flying is one of the most carbon-emitting actions”
Now my son is a captain in an airline flying around the world. Its his livelihood and “careless talk means jobs!”
So I checked out the statement and found this data in the graphic below and established that flying accounts for 1.9% of emissions
Now that is below
ü 10.9% from residential homes
ü 11.9% from road traffic
ü 12.4% from manufacturing and construction
ü 11.8% from agriculture
ü 6.5% from land use change (including deforestation fires)
I know that our challenge is to reduce emissions across the board and flying is no exception. The airlines are using more efficient aircraft today but they will have to find even better solutions soon
